A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
The recent wave of insider stock sales at
, Inc. (NRG) has sparked debate among investors about whether these transactions signal underlying concerns or merely reflect routine wealth management. With key executives unloading millions of dollars in shares over the past year, the question remains: Does this activity erode investor confidence, or is it a misinterpretation of strategic financial planning? Let's dissect the data and its implications.Over the past 24 months, NRG executives have sold a staggering $13.36 million in company stock, with Rasesh M. Patel, Executive VP of Smart Home & President, leading the sales. His transactions—most notably a $8.24 million sale in September 2024—are part of a pattern that raises eyebrows. However, the most dramatic move came from Robert J. Gaudette, Executive Vice President of NRG Business, who sold 5.48 million shares in January 2025 for $500.7 million. This single transaction alone dwarfs all other sales, prompting immediate scrutiny.
Insider selling is often perceived as a negative signal. As Peter Lynch famously noted, “Insiders might sell their shares for any number of reasons, but they buy them for only one: they think the price will rise.” While executives may sell due to personal financial needs or diversification, the sheer volume of sales at NRG—especially from top leadership—demands attention. Notably, no executives bought stock in the past year, further tilting the balance toward caution.
A sharp decline in NRG's stock price around January 2025 coincides with Gaudette's massive sale, suggesting potential investor skepticism.
NRG's financials, however, paint a more nuanced picture. The company has maintained a robust $0.44 quarterly dividend (up from $0.36 in 2024) and reaffirmed plans to return $1.645 billion to shareholders in 2025 through dividends and buybacks. By April 2025, it had already returned $532 million via these channels. These actions signal confidence in cash flow stability.
Yet, the disconnect between leadership's selling and corporate messaging is stark. While executives are converting derivative securities (e.g., stock options) into shares—a move often tied to performance milestones—the timing of these transactions raises questions. For instance, Gaudette's sale occurred just days after receiving new stock grants, which might imply a strategy to lock in gains before potential dilution.
NRG's focus on renewables—its core business—faces mounting challenges. Rising capital costs for solar and wind projects, coupled with regulatory uncertainty in key markets, could strain margins. While the company's dividend hikes reflect short-term stability, long-term growth hinges on execution in a competitive space. If executives are selling amid these pressures, it may indicate a lack of conviction in NRG's ability to navigate these hurdles.
Only 0.61% insider ownership suggests limited “skin in the game.”
Countervailing Factors:
While NRG's fundamentals are not yet in freefall, the scale of insider selling—particularly from top decision-makers—cannot be ignored. Investors should consider:
- Reducing exposure until leadership stabilizes or reverses its selling trend.
- Monitoring stock price reactions to upcoming earnings reports and regulatory updates.
Historically, the stock has underperformed following earnings announcements. A strategy of buying NRG on earnings announcement dates and holding for 20 days from 2020 to 2025 generated an average return of just 15.3%, compared to a 99% benchmark return. With a maximum drawdown of 35.66% and a Sharpe ratio of 0.13, this strategy demonstrated poor risk-adjusted performance, reinforcing the need for caution around earnings-related volatility.
Competitors show net insider buying, while NRG's activity is overwhelmingly negative.
NRG's executive sell-off is a cautionary signal that warrants investor vigilance. While the company's dividend discipline and renewable push remain positives, the lack of insider confidence at this critical juncture is a strategic misstep. Until leadership demonstrates alignment with shareholders via buybacks or new stock purchases, prudence dictates a hold or reduce position stance. The energy transition is a long game—one that may demand more than just dividends to keep investors on board.
Act now before the market catches up to the signals insiders are sending.
AI Writing Agent built with a 32-billion-parameter reasoning system, it explores the interplay of new technologies, corporate strategy, and investor sentiment. Its audience includes tech investors, entrepreneurs, and forward-looking professionals. Its stance emphasizes discerning true transformation from speculative noise. Its purpose is to provide strategic clarity at the intersection of finance and innovation.

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025

Dec.19 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et